The Apollo sounder base is typically used in fire alarm systems to alert building occupants of a fire or other emergency situations. It is designed to produce a loud, distinctive sound that can be heard throughout the building. The sounder base is connected to the fire alarm control panel via wiring, which carries the signals necessary for triggering the sounder in case of an alarm.

The apollo sounder base wiring diagram typically includes the following components:

1. Sounder base terminals: The wiring diagram will indicate the different terminals on the sounder base, such as the positive (+) and negative (-) terminals. These terminals are used to connect the sounder base to the control panel and power source.

2. Control panel connections: The diagram will specify how the sounder base should be wired to the fire alarm control panel. This includes connecting the positive and negative terminals to the appropriate terminals on the control panel.

3. Power source connections: The wiring diagram will also include information on how the sounder base should be connected to the power source, such as a battery or power supply. It will specify the voltage and current requirements for the sounder base.

4. Additional components: Depending on the specific fire alarm system setup, the wiring diagram may include instructions for connecting other components, such as detectors, call points, or relays, to the sounder base.
